Job Description

The Harvard Library Innovation Lab (LIL) seeks a User Support Coordinator to help us build tools and communities for open knowledge. Located at the Harvard Law Library, LIL is a fun and collaborative lab with a broad mission focused on re-envisioning how knowledge is created, preserved, and accessed. Please visit our website at (Use the "Apply for this Job" box below). for a sense of our current projects and activities.

LIL’s projects can range from large to small and can bring immediate benefit or prototype the future. Passion and creativity are required, as well as the ability to work collaboratively on long-term and short-term projects with a great team.

Our work is open-source and openly available, with an eye to broad public interest impact. All of our team members participate in choosing and pursuing our research direction, and we welcome applicants with a strong sense of how they seek to make an impact through our work.

Responsibilities
  • Provide support via email, Zoom, and in person to users of the Lab’s software.
  • Create educational materials and documentation for users of the Lab’s software.
  • Serve as main point of contact for user questions and troubleshoot problems.
  • Triage incoming email to the general inquiry inbox and assign to relevant team members.
  • Discuss patron needs with users and represent those needs in team meetings, helping us to form product strategy.
  • Learn in-depth features of our tools in order to teach them to others.
  • Prepare high-quality bug reports for software developers.
  • Participate in user outreach and community development for LIL projects; including social media, blog posts, promoting platforms to potential partners; coordinating symposiums or workshops.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
